This elegant open-heart funeral tribute is handcrafted by our expert florists using delicate gypsophila and a single premium white rose, symbolising purity, remembrance and sincere affection. Fresh trailing ivy completes the design, creating a soft, romantic shape that beautifully frames your heartfelt goodbye.

Perfect as a funeral tribute, memorial arrangement or to honour a special anniversary, this white heart wreath offers a gentle, timeless way to say "you will always be in our hearts." Each tribute is made to order, ensuring the freshest flowers and a unique finish for your loved one.

The Infinite Love Tribute measures approximately 43cm x 42cm, with the deluxe size pictured. Due to seasonal availability, some flowers may be substituted with equal or higher quality stems in a similar colour palette, while maintaining the overall style. Roses are delivered with their natural guard petals to protect the inner blooms during transit; these can be gently removed on arrival for the perfect display.
